What is the going rate for commercial painting per square foot?

For commercial painting jobs, the typical rate ranges from $1.50 to $4.00 per square foot, depending on factors such as surface condition, type of paint, and job complexity. Experienced painters may charge higher rates, especially for detailed or high-access areas, and costs can vary based on location and project size.

Can a painter make 100k a year?

A painter can potentially earn $100,000 annually, especially if they are experienced, work in high-demand areas, or run their own business. Achieving this income often requires advanced skills, a strong client base, and efficient project management. Many painters supplement their income through specialization or additional certifications.

What is the best way to find painting jobs?

Painting jobs can be found through online job boards, local classifieds, and industry-specific websites. Networking with contractors, building a portfolio, and obtaining relevant certifications can also improve job prospects. Consistently applying and maintaining a good reputation are key to securing work in this field.

What is the highest paid painting job?

In the painting industry, commercial and industrial painters often earn higher wages than residential painters due to the complexity and scale of projects. Specialized roles such as industrial coating applicators or unionized painters tend to have higher pay, especially when working on large-scale or high-risk projects that require advanced skills and certifications. Experience, location, and union membership can also influence earning potential.
